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.
Balises
Important
Le AWS OpsWorks Stacks service a atteint sa fin de vie le 26 mai 2024 et a été désactivé tant pour les nouveaux clients que pour les clients existants. Nous recommandons vivement aux clients de migrer leurs charges de travail vers d'autres solutions dès que possible. Si vous avez des questions sur la migration, contactez l' AWS Support équipe sur AWS Re:Post
Les balises peuvent vous aider à regrouper des ressources dans des piles Chef 11.10, Chef 12 et Chef 12.2, et suivre les coûts d'utilisation de ces ressources dans AWS Billing and Cost Management.
Vous pouvez appliquer des balises au niveau de la pile et de la couche. Lorsque vous créez une balise, vous appliquez la balise à chaque ressource au sein de la structure balisée. Par exemple, si vous appliquez une balise à une couche, vous l'appliquez à chaque instance, à chaque volume Amazon EBS (sauf la racine) ou à chaque équilibreur de charge Elastic Load Balancing de la couche. Les balises ne peuvent pas actuellement être appliquées au volume racine, ou volume EBS par défaut, d'une instance.
Les balises sont des paires clé-valeur que vous attribuez à des piles ou à des couches dans Stacks. AWS OpsWorks Après avoir créé des balises, ouvrez la console Billing and Cost Management pour activer les balises définies par l'utilisateur. Pour plus d'informations sur la façon d'activer vos tags et de les utiliser pour suivre et gérer les coûts de vos ressources AWS OpsWorks Stacks, consultez les sections Utilisation des balises de répartition des coûts et activation des balises de répartition des coûts définies par l'utilisateur dans le guide de l'utilisateur de Billing and Cost Management.
Les balises fonctionnent de la même manière que les attributs personnalisés dans AWS OpsWorks Stacks. Les balises que vous appliquez à une pile sont héritées par chaque couche de la pile. Au niveau de la couche, vous pouvez remplacer les valeurs (mais pas les noms de clé) des balises héritées et ajouter de nouvelles balises spécifiques à la couche. AWS OpsWorks applique le jeu de balises obtenu à toutes les ressources de la couche. A mesure que vous créez de nouvelles ressources ou attribuez des ressources existantes à une couche, les nouvelles ressources de la couche sont balisées avec le même ensemble de balises.
Rubriques
Configuration des balises au niveau de la pile
Au niveau de la pile, vous pouvez ajouter et gérer des balises en choisissant Balises sur la page d'accueil de la pile.
Sur la page Balises, ajoutez des balises sous forme de paires clé-valeur. La capture d'écran suivante montre des exemples de balises. Vous pouvez supprimer des balises en sélectionnant le X rouge à droite d'une paire clé-valeur.
Configuration des balises au niveau d'une couche
Au niveau d'une couche, définissez des balises en choisissant l'onglet Balises. Vous pouvez trouver cet onglet sur la page d'accueil Layers (Couches) et la page d'accueil de chaque couche.
Lorsque vous modifiez ou ajoutez des balises au niveau d'une couche, gardez à l'esprit que les balises qui ont été ajoutées au niveau de la pile parent sont héritées par la couche et ses ressources. Si vous pouvez modifier les valeurs de balises héritées, vous ne pouvez pas modifier les noms de clé, ou supprimer des balises héritées. Modifiez les noms de clé ou supprimez les balises héritées de la pile parent dans les paramètres de la pile. La capture d'écran suivante montre des exemples de balises héritées du niveau de la pile. Les balises héritées sont grisées.
Pour plus d'informations sur l'ajout de balises à des piles, consultez Créer une pile. Pour plus d'informations sur l'ajout de balises à des couches, consultez Modification de OpsWorks la configuration d'une couche.
Gérer les tags à l'aide du AWS CLI
Vous pouvez également utiliser des AWS CLI commandes pour ajouter et supprimer des balises au niveau de la pile et de la couche. Pour plus d'informations sur le téléchargement et l'installation du AWS CLI, voir Installation de l'interface de ligne de AWS
commande. N'oubliez pas d'ajouter le paramètre --region
à votre commande si la pile que vous voulez baliser n'est pas dans votre région par défaut. Les ARN des couches n'apparaissent pas actuellement dans le AWS Management Console. Pour obtenir l'ARN d'une couche, exécutez la commande describe-layers.
Pour ajouter des balises à l'aide du AWS CLI
-
À l'invite de AWS CLI commande, tapez la commande suivante, en remplaçant
Stack_or_Layer_ARN
et en spécifiant vos balises de paire clé-valeur, puis appuyez sur Entrée. L'échappement des guillemets est effectué avec des barres obliques inverses.aws opsworks tag-resource --resource-arn
stack_or_layer_ARN
--tags "{\"key
\":\"value
\",\"key
\":\"value
\"}"Voici un exemple.
aws opsworks tag-resource --resource-arn arn:aws:opsworks:us-east-2:800000000003:stack/500b99c0-ec00-4cgg-8a0d-1000000jjd1b --tags "{\"Stage\":\"Production\",\"Organization\":\"Mobile\"}"
Pour supprimer des balises à l'aide du AWS CLI
-
À l'invite de AWS CLI commande, tapez ce qui suit, puis appuyez sur Entrée.
aws opsworks untag-resource --resource-arn
stack_or_layer_ARN
--tag-keys "[\"key
\",\"key
\"]"Pour supprimer des balises, vous spécifiez uniquement la clé de la balise que vous voulez supprimer. Voici un exemple.
aws opsworks untag-resource --resource-arn arn:aws:opsworks:us-east-2:800000000003:stack/500b99c0-ec00-4cgg-8a0d-1000000jjd1b --tag-keys "[\"Stage\",\"Organization\"]"
Note
Vous ne pouvez pas supprimer des balises héritées (des balises qui ont été ajoutées au niveau de la pile parent) d'une couche. Vous devez supprimer les balises héritées à partir de la pile.
Limitations des balises
Gardez les limitations suivantes à l'esprit lorsque vous créez des balises.
-
AWS OpsWorks Stacks limite le nombre de balises définies par l'utilisateur au niveau de la pile et de la couche à 40, y compris les balises définies par l'utilisateur héritées d'un niveau parent. Cela laisse 10 emplacements disponibles pour les balises par défaut qui sont précédées et
opsworks:
les balises définies par d'autres AWS processus. Un maximum de 50 balises est autorisé sur une ressource, y compris les balises définies par l'utilisateur et les balises par défaut créées par AWS. -
Les clés de balise ne peuvent pas commencer par
aws:
,opsworks:
ourds:
. Ne pas utilisername
ouName
comme clé de tag, car elleName
est réservée par AWS OpsWorks Stacks. -
Une clé peut comporter 127 caractères au maximum et ne peut contenir que des lettres, des chiffres ou séparateurs Unicode, ou les caractères spéciaux suivants :
+ - = . _ : /
. -
Une valeur peut comporter 255 caractères au maximum et ne peut contenir que des lettres, des chiffres ou séparateurs Unicode, ou les caractères spéciaux suivants :
+ - = . _ : /
.